蛾 centers on a moth, a winged insect related to butterflies but typically nocturnal and less colorful.
蛾 combines 虫 (insect) with 我, which likely contributes the sound. The character specifically denotes a moth.
The insect radical 虫 on the left tells you it's a bug, and the right side 我 looks like a moth with its wings spread. Together, 蛾 is a moth.
